Select a reliable payment method

In order to place bets with an online sportsbook in Canada, you need to fund your account with one of the accepted payment methods. PayPal betting sites are sadly no longer permitted, but there are similar eWallet alternatives such as ecoPayz and MuchBetter, both of which are now being seen more often on betting sites in Canada.

Visa and MasterCard debit and credit cards can be used for transactions with bookmakers in Canada, but some banks may block this. Interac is generally an easier card to use, but only a handful of bookmakers allow this as a payment method.

iDebit and Instadebit are options on many sportsbooks, whilst Citadel, eCheck, EntroPay and Paysafecard can be found on a range of betting sites too. Even Bitcoin is making its way into the sports betting sphere.

Claim a welcome bonus and set a bankroll

The majority of online betting sites offer a welcome bonus to Canadian players, and they are usually either a matched first deposit or free bet(s). You should only deposit what you can afford, even if the bookie offers you a 100% matched deposit up to a large figure such as $200, as is the case with Bet365.

If $50 is the amount you feel comfortable with depositing, then stick with that, and you can still grab an extra $50 with a sign up offer, which takes your total to $100. Bonus money is usually subject to wagering requirements, so you need to bet that money a certain number of times before it can be withdrawn.

It is recommended that you keep your stakes for each bet somewhere between 1-5% of your bankroll.
